检查系统要求

  • 操作系统: macOS 10.15+、Ubuntu 20.04+/Debian 10+ 或通过 WSL 的 Windows
  • 硬件: 最少 4GB RAM
  • 软件:
    • Node.js 18+
    • git 2.23+(可选)
    • GitHubGitLab CLI 用于 PR 工作流程(可选)
  • 网络: 需要互联网连接进行认证和 AI 处理
  • 地区: 仅在支持的国家可用

WSL 安装故障排除

目前,Claude Code 不能直接在 Windows 中运行,而是需要 WSL。如果您在 WSL 中遇到问题:

  1. 操作系统/平台检测问题: 如果您在安装过程中收到错误,WSL 可能正在使用 Windows 的 npm。请尝试:

    • 在安装前运行 npm config set os linux
    • 使用 npm install -g @anthropic-ai/claude-code --force --no-os-check 安装(不要使用 sudo
  2. 找不到 Node 错误: 如果您在运行 claude 时看到 exec: node: not found,您的 WSL 环境可能正在使用 Windows 安装的 Node.js。您可以通过 which npmwhich node 确认这一点,它们应该指向以 /usr/ 开头的 Linux 路径,而不是 /mnt/c/。要解决此问题,请尝试通过您的 Linux 发行版的包管理器或通过 nvm 安装 Node。

安装和认证

1

安装 Claude Code

To install Claude Code, run the following command:

npm install -g @anthropic-ai/claude-code
2

导航到您的项目

bash cd your-project-directory

3

启动 Claude Code

bash claude
4

完成认证

Claude Code 提供多种认证选项:1. Anthropic Console: 默认选项。通过 Anthropic Console 连接并完成 OAuth 流程。需要在 console.anthropic.com 激活计费。2. Claude App(Pro 或 Max 计划): 订阅 Claude 的 Pro 或 Max 计划,获得包含 Claude Code 和 Web 界面的统一订阅。以相同价格获得更多价值,同时在一个地方管理您的账户。使用您的 Claude.ai 账户登录。在启动期间,选择与您的订阅类型匹配的选项。3. 企业平台: 配置 Claude Code 使用 Amazon Bedrock 或 Google Vertex AI 进行企业部署,使用您现有的云基础设施。

初始化您的项目

对于首次使用的用户,我们建议:

1

启动 Claude Code

bash claude
2

运行一个简单命令

bash summarize this project
3

生成 CLAUDE.md 项目指南

bash /init
4

提交生成的 CLAUDE.md 文件

要求 Claude 将生成的 CLAUDE.md 文件提交到您的仓库。